Occitaniasearch for termAlso: lo País d'Òc, the Oc Country. The region in southern Europe (the southern half of France, Monaco, small part of Italy and Spain) where Occitan was historically the main language spoken.

Oelbermannsearch for termRobert Oelbermann (24.4.1896-29.3.1941). Founder of Nerother Bund, perhaps he was the prisoner of Dachau with whom Otto was accused of fraternizing during his time there (circa 1937). Died in Dachau. On the photo at right
Karl Oelbermann (24.4.1896-9.10.1974), otherwise known as 'King Oelb'. Twin brother of Robert Oelbermann. Initiator(?) for Otto Rahn Monument building in Hunsrück (1964), leader of Nerother Bund. On the photo at leftSee also: Dachau, Nerother Bund
Ornolacsearch for termCaves near Montsegur where Otto Rahn spent a lot of time searching for the Grail traces.
